Bournemouth cuts planning posts

15 December 2008

Bournemouth Borough Council's planning department is axing 13 jobs as a result of a 34 per cent drop in planning applications since last year.

Appointment at Ecotricity

12 December 2008

Electricity supplier and wind farm developer Ecotricity has recruited Andrew Muir as a senior project manager. He joins from National Grid Wireless, where he was regional planning manager. His new role will focus on taking projects through the appeal process.

Asset deal secures renewal in Croydon

12 December 2008

John Laing and the London Borough of Croydon have sealed a £450 million deal to regenerate four town centre sites with housing, retail and a council headquarters.
